Building Trust in AI: A Guide for Business Leaders

AI systems rarely fail because of a flawed launch—they fail because organizations mistake initial trust for permanent trust. Whether in pricing, underwriting, or customer service, the real challenge isn't gaining approval or executive buy-in; it's ensuring someone continues to validate that the model remains accurate, relevant, and worthy of reliance as business conditions evolve. Building trust in AI is not a one-time milestone but an ongoing governance discipline, where continuous monitoring, retraining, and human oversight determine whether an AI investment delivers lasting value or quietly drifts into irrelevance.
